JOB TITLE: Asphalt/ Aggregate Quality Control Technician

GENERAL STATEMENT OF DUTIES:  Performs general skilled or unskilled construction related activities for quarry and field products.

SUPERVISION RECEIVED:    Reports directly to supervisor or project superintendent.

SUPERVISION EXERCISED:     None.

TYPICAL PHYSICAL DEMANDS   Requires full range of body motion including handling and operating various hand and power tools, manual and finger dexterity and eye-hand coordination. Requires standing and bending over for extended periods of time. Requires reaching, crawling, climbing, grasping, kneeling, squatting, and twisting. Often requires lifting, carrying, pushing and/or pulling items weighing up to 90 pounds. Sometimes requires working at heights. Requires correct vision and hearing within normal range. Requires working under stressful conditions.  This is a safety sensitive position.

TYPICAL WORKING CONDITIONS:  Frequent exposure to rain, sleet, snow, dust, mud, heat, cold, noise and other conditions common to a construction site. Irregular hours, nights, weekends, swing shifts and holidays may be required for contractual obligations.

EXAMPLES OF DUTIES:  (This may not include all of the duties assigned)

  1. Monitors and tests for quarry rock crushing and sorting process.
  2. Monitors and tests for hot asphalt operation.
  3. Samples aggregates and asphalts.
  4. Performs laboratory and field tests, and related work as required.
  5. Understands and uses arithmetic including fractions and decimals, and has clean legible handwriting.
  6. Light data entry and computer use required.
  7. Learns, knows, and understands Colorado Procedures (CP’s) and AASHTO.
  8. Willingness to cross train, and task train when needed.
  9. Communicates with production plants, and field representatives including but not limited to superintendents, CDOT, owners assurance, and process control.
  10. Maintains a clean workspace.
  11. Knows and understands, as well as follows, the rules and regulations of the Company “Employee Safety Policy and Handbook.”
  12. Performs other duties as required.
  13. Heavy lifting up to 90 lbs. required several times daily
